summ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orHan Wang <416810799@qq.com>2021-06-03 05:09:21 +0200
committerBruno Martins <bgcngm@gmail.com>2021-06-03 10:23:08 +0200
commit162d0fd36479769448a8384973c2329eda6a2516 (patch)
tree3158530844b05af3404e6ec5ee36949309236bf5
parent1bc4dc52ca46ed6a95b32a79611dde71ff2d431c (diff)
PerformanceManagerService: Account for QCOM perf HAL 2.1/2.2
Change-Id: Icb57a6b3a5ff72222983eafd40a7bc9db45d60f8
-rw-r--r--lineage/lib/main/java/org/lineageos/platform/internal/PerformanceManagerService.java4
1 files changed, 3 insertions, 1 deletions
diff --git a/lineage/lib/main/java/org/lineageos/platform/internal/PerformanceManagerService.java b/lineage/lib/main/java/org/lineageos/platform/internal/PerformanceManagerService.java
index 3c4a5455..13d897a8 100644
--- a/lineage/lib/main/java/org/lineageos/platform/internal/PerformanceManagerService.java
+++ b/lineage/lib/main/java/org/lineageos/platform/internal/PerformanceManagerService.java
@@ -1,6 +1,6 @@
/*
* Copyright (C) 2014 The CyanogenMod Project
- * 2018-2020 The LineageOS Project
+ * 2018-2021 The LineageOS Project
*
* Licensed under the Apache License, Version 2.0 (the "License");
* you may not use this file except in compliance with the License.
@@ -136,6 +136,8 @@ public class PerformanceManagerService extends LineageSystemService {
SystemProperties.get("init.svc.vendor.perfd").equals("running") ||
SystemProperties.get("init.svc.perf-hal-1-0").equals("running") ||
SystemProperties.get("init.svc.perf-hal-2-0").equals("running") ||
+ SystemProperties.get("init.svc.perf-hal-2-1").equals("running") ||
+ SystemProperties.get("init.svc.perf-hal-2-2").equals("running") ||
SystemProperties.get("init.svc.mpdecision").equals("running")) {
break;
}